Egg Vs. Chicken Goes FREE For The First Time

It really seems to me that the egg wouldn't stand a fighting chance, but whatever. Egg Vs. Chicken (iPhone) is free, it's developed by acclaimed Diner Dash creators PlayFirst, and it's cute as heck.



148Apps: 4.5/5 "Egg vs. Chicken is one of those rare gems that I have to encourage as many people as possible to buy. It’s cute, it’s easy to play and it entices you into playing for much much longer than you’d envisage. It could well be the next Plants vs. Zombies or Angry Birds. It certainly deserves to be."

TouchGen: 4/5  "I got really surprised by Egg vs. Chicken, and it shows that you should not judge an app by its name. Instead of being a clone it brings a completely unique gameplay formula to the App Store, and it is a fun one at that. If you are into match three games or barricade defence games this title comes highly recommended."

SlideToPlay: 3/4  "It has a great sense of humor, complete with ridiculous animation, and its sharp interface makes navigating the game a breeze. The cramped play space, which is constantly spammed by eggs with touchy controls, does diminish our enthusiasm. Still, it is a good game, especially for Match-3 addicts looking for a fresh fix."
